nbd: Consistent typedef usage in header
We had a mix of struct declarations followed by typedefs, and direct struct definitions as part of a typedef. Pick a single style. Also float forward declarations of opaque types to the top of the file, rather than interspersed with function declarations, which will help a future patch that wants to expose yet another opaque type that will be referenced in NBDRequest. No semantic impact.
